How Much TetraMin Food Should You Feed Your Betta Fish?
When it comes to feeding your betta fish, it is important to remember that betta fish should only be fed small amounts of food at one time. Betta fish have small stomachs, and they will only be able to consume small amounts of food at one time. It is best to feed your betta fish only a few flakes at a time, no more than what they can consume in two minutes. It is also important to remove any uneaten food, as it can quickly become contaminated and make your betta fish sick.
It is also important to remember that betta fish should not be overfed. Betta fish that are overfed can suffer from a variety of health problems, such as bloating and swim bladder disease. Overfeeding can also lead to an increase in water pollution, as the uneaten food will break down and contaminate the water. It is best to feed your betta fish only as much food as they can consume in two minutes.

Can Betta Fish Eat Vegetables?
Betta fish can also be fed vegetables. Vegetables are an excellent source of fiber, and they can help keep your betta's digestive system functioning properly. Common vegetables that can be fed to betta fish include blanched peas, spinach, and zucchini. It is important to remember that vegetables should be blanched before feeding them to your betta fish. Blanching involves boiling or steaming the vegetables for a few minutes before feeding them to your betta fish.
It is also important to remember that betta fish should not be fed too many vegetables. Vegetables should make up only a small portion of your betta's diet, as they can cause digestive problems if they are fed in large amounts. Vegetables should only be fed to your betta fish once or twice a week.
